Output de4fabac8a177ace1cf73e56c2357f5e0c8ac8a75fb7d8650799a1f4b4f13e2d:66

value
114780
script pubkey
OP_0 OP_PUSHBYTES_32 c7b4d9a2fb8b61a0d96a6018cfc46f995539296df2978054f26c6bb97c63f962
address
bc1qc76dnghm3ds6pkt2vqvvl3r0n92nj2td72tcq48jd34mjlrrl93qrzmjr4
transaction
de4fabac8a177ace1cf73e56c2357f5e0c8ac8a75fb7d8650799a1f4b4f13e2d
confirmations
184604
spent
true